* {
	font-size : 12px;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	text-decoration: none;
	color: #666;
}

p.bodytext {
	color: #666;
}


body {
	margin-top: 0;
	margin-left: 0;
	background-color: #FFFFFF;
	color: #666;

}

	
body#titelliste  {
	background-color: #fffffb;
	margin-top: 0; 
	margin-left: 0;
	color: #666;
}


h2{
	font-weight : bold;
	font-size : 12px;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
        margin-bottom : 4px;
        color: #535353;
}


#contentrechts h2{
	font-weight: bold;
	font-size: 12px;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
        margin-bottom : 4px;
        color: #fff;
}


#bild {
	margin: 0;
}

#austellung-bildHG{
	background: #333 url(../ubi/06_contentrechts_bg.gif) repeat;
        margin-top: 0; margin-left: 0;
}


#contentbox {
	margin: 25px 0px 25px 25px; width: 500px;
	color: #666666;
	
}

#contentbox0 {
	margin: 0; 
	width: 500px;
	color: #666666;
}

#content {
	margin: 0px 0px 24px 24px; 
	font-family: Verdana; 
	color: #666666;
	font-size: 10px;
}


#contentbox table {
	color: #666666;
}

table td,
table th {
	vertical-align:top;
}


#contentboxtop {margin: 0px 0px 0px 24px; width: 700px; height: 150px;}
.kategorietop {margin: 0px 0px 20px 0px; font-family: Verdana; color: #999; font-size: 12px; font-weight: bold;}

#bild {margin: 0px 0px 0px 0px; width: 150px; float: left;}
#text {margin: 0px 0px 0px 0px; float: left;}
#showtitel{font-family: Verdana; font-size: 12px; font-weight: bold; margin: 0px 0px 0px 0px; color: #666}
#showtext {font-family: Verdana; margin: 12px 0px 0px 0px; color: #666}

body#bilderband { margin-top: 0; margin-left: 0; background: #000; color: #666}
#bilderband {height: 130px; width: 850px; background: url(../ubi/06_contentrechts_bg.gif) repeat; color: #666}

BODY#kuenstlerliste {
	margin-top: 0; margin-left: 0; background: #000 url(../ubi/06_contentrechts_bg.gif) repeat; color: #666
}


div#contentrechts {
	margin: 0;
	padding: 17px 10px 20px 10px; 
	font-family: Verdana; 
	color: #fff;
	font-size: 12px;
}

div#kuenstlerlistelink{
	color : #FFFFFF;
	font-weight : bold;
	font-size : 11px;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	margin-bottom : 4px;
	text-decoration: none;
}
div#kuenstlerlistelink:hover {
	color:#f08d32;
}

div#kuenstlerlistelinkACT{
	color : #EA8400;
	font-weight : bold;
	font-size : 11px;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	margin-bottom : 4px;
	text-decoration: none;
}


A:ACTIVE,
A:FOCUS,
A:HOVER,
A:LINK,
A:VISITED {
	text-decoration: none;
	/*color: #666;*/
	color:#C17228;
	outline:none;
}

a font {
	color:#C17228;
}



div#titelliste  {margin: 0px 0px 0px 0px; padding: 17px 10px 20px 10px; font-family: Verdana; color: #666; font-size: 12px;}
#titellistetitel{
	color : #666666;
	font-weight : bold;
	font-size : 11px;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	margin-bottom : 4px;
}

#titellistelink {
	color : #666666;
	font-weight: bold;
	font-size: 11px;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	margin-bottom: 21px;
}


BODY#shopproduct {
	color : #666666 !important ;
	margin-top: 0; margin-left: 0;
	font-size: 11px !important ;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
}



/**************************************************


eMP Applikationsbereich

**************************************************/



body.standard *,
body.standard2 * {
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 11px;
}

body.standard {
	margin:0 5px 10px 25px;
}

body.standard2 {
	margin:0 50px 10px 25px;
}

body.iframe{
	margin:0;
}

body.standard a,
body.standard2 a {
	color:#c17228;
}

body.standard h1,
body.standard2 h1 {
	padding:0;
	margin:0;
	font-size:15px;
	text-transform:uppercase;
	color:#535353;
	font-size:11px;
	letter-spacing:4px;
}

body.standard h2,
body.standard2 h2 {
	padding:0;
	margin: 20px 0 0 0;
}

body.standard #recherche,
body.standard2 #recherche {
	margin:0;
	padding:30px 0 0 0;
	visibility: hidden;
}

body.standard a#sam_ausw {
	background-color: #5c92c9;
	display: block;
	width: 250px;
	height: 34px;
	font-weight: bold;
	color: white;
	margin-right: 0;
	margin-left: 0;
	margin-bottom: 0;
	padding: 3px 0 0 10px;
}

body.standard a:hover#sam_ausw {
	background-color: #80b4e9;
}

body.standard a#sam_kopl {
	margin:0;
	padding: 3px 0 0 10px;
	background-color: #115eb6;
	display: block;
	width: 250px;
	height: 34px;
	font-weight: bold;
	color: white;
}

body.standard a:hover#sam_kopl {
	background-color: #3c88df;
}

body.standard #recherche a,
body.standard2 #recherche a {
	font-size:25px;
	color:#ccc;
	display:block;
	text-indent: -28px;
	margin-left: 28px;

}

body#navigationRight {
	/* background: #000 url(../images/rightCol_bg.png) repeat 0 0; */
	background: #333333 url(../ubi/06_contentrechts_bg.gif) repeat 0 0;

	padding-top: 20px;
}



#navigationRight  #recherche {
	display: none;
	position: absolute;
	font-weight : bold;
	font-size : 11px;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	padding: 5px 5px 0 12px;
}

#navigationRight h2 {
	padding-left: 20px;
	/*padding-top: 11px;*/
	font-size: 11px;
	color: #fff;
}
/*
*+html
*/
#navigationRight .navigation {
	width: 149px;
	padding: 27px 0 0 0;
	margin: 0;
	list-style: none;
	/* background: url(../images/navigationRight_bg.png) repeat-x 0 0; */
}

#navigationRight .navigation li {
	padding: 0;
	background: none;
}

#navigationRight .navigation li a {
	display: block;
	padding: 1px 0 7px 12px;
	
	color : #999;
	font-weight : bold;
	font-size : 11px;
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	margin-bottom : 4px;
	text-decoration: none;
	width: 149px;
	width: 130px !important;
}
#navigationRight .navigation li a:hover {
	color: #f08d32;
}

#navigationRight .navigation li.first a {
	padding: 1px 0 19px 12px;
}

#navigationRight .navigation li.act a {
	color : #FFF;
}


table.FEUserRegistration,
table.newLoginBox,
table.empTitle {
	background-color:#ccc;
	width:455px;
	color:#666;
	font-weight:bold;
}

table.newLoginBox,
table.empTitle {
	width:659px;
}

table.empTitle {
	width:674px;
}

table.FEUserRegistration tr,
table.newLoginBox tr,
table.empTitle tr {
	height:24px;
}


table.FEUserRegistration  tr.even,
table.newLoginBox tr.even,
table.empTitle tr.even {
	background: #333 url(../images/background.gif) repeat;
	background-color:#ccc;
}


table.FEUserRegistration td,
table.newLoginBox td,
table.empTitle td {
	padding:3px 0px 3px 10px;
	vertical-align:middle;
}

table.FEUserRegistration td.label,
table.newLoginBox td.label {
	width: 130px;
}

table.FEUserRegistration select,
table.FEUserRegistration input,
table.newLoginBox input {
	border:0px;
	width:250px;
	height:20px;
}

table.newLoginBox input.button {
	background: none;
	color: #666;
	cursor: pointer;
	width: auto;
	color:#000000 !important;
	font-weight:bold;
}

table.newLoginBox input.logout {
	padding: 0;
	/*margin-left: -2px !important;
	margin-left: -10px; */
	color:#000000;
	font-weight:bold;
}

table.newLoginBox input.logout:hover {
	color: #fff;
}

body.standard p.loginBox a,
body.standard a.loginBox,
body.standard2 p.loginBox a,
body.standard2 a.loginBox {
	color: #f18d32  !important;
	font-weight: bold;
}

.iframe iframe {
	height: 1000px;
}

.info {
	color:#4F4F4F;
	font-size:10px;
}

.error {
	color:red;
}

.inpagenavigation {
	float:left;
}

/* Gallery */

.tx-wsgallery-pi1,
.tx-wsgallery-pi1 table.galleryImage,
.tx-wsgallery-pi1 table.galleryBrowser {
	width: 260px;
}

.tx-wsgallery-pi1 table.galleryImage {
	height: 355px;
}

.tx-wsgallery-pi1 .caption {
	text-align: left;
	color: #666;
	font-size: 9px;
}

.tx-wsgallery-pi1 .back,
.tx-wsgallery-pi1 .forward {
	width:60px;
}

.tx-wsgallery-pi1 .divider {
	width:130px;
	float:left;
}

/* -----------------------------------------------
	csc-texpicstyles
----------------------------------------------- */

div.csc-textpic div.csc-textpic-imagewrap .csc-textpic-image .csc-textpic-caption {
	font-size:10px;
	margin:0pt;
}

div.csc-textpic div.csc-textpic-imagewrap .csc-textpic-image {
	margin-bottom:10px;
}

/* -----------------------------------------------
	Presse Bereich
	austellungFrame - PIDinRootline = 313, 316, 319
----------------------------------------------- */

#contentbox-2 {
	margin: 25px 0px 25px 25px;
	width: 580px;
}

.standard #contentbox-2 {
	margin: 0;
}

.standard #contentbox-2 table.newLoginBox {
	width: 590px;
}

#austellungFrame * {
	color: #666;
}

/* version 31 */
#austellungFrame .version31 {
	display: block;
	width: 145px;
	margin-bottom: 25px;
	float: left;
}

#austellungFrame .version31 .csc-textpic-imagewrap {
	height: 100px;
	margin-bottom: 10px;
	overflow: hidden;	
}

#austellungFrame .version31 .bodytext {
	padding-right: 10px;
}

#austellungFrame .version31 .csc-textpic-text {
	/*height: 63px !important;
	height: 53px;
	overflow: hidden;*/
}

*+html #austellungFrame .version31 .csc-textpic-text {
	height: 40px !important;
}

/* version 32 */
#austellungFrame .version32 {
	margin-bottom: 25px;
}

#austellungFrame .version32 .csc-textpic-imagewrap {
	width: 280px;
	margin-bottom: 15px;
	margin-right: 40px !important;
}

/* allgemein */
#austellungFrame .version0 .bodytext a,
#austellungFrame .version0 .bodytext a * {
	color: #f18d32;
}

#austellungFrame .version31 .bodytext,
#austellungFrame .version31 .bodytext a,
#austellungFrame .version32 .bodytext,
#austellungFrame .version32 .bodytext a,
#austellungFrame .version31 .bodytext *,
#austellungFrame .version32 .bodytext * {
	font-size: 11px;
	color: #666;
}

.clear {
	clear: both;
}

/* -----------------------------------------------
	table styles
----------------------------------------------- */

/* contenttable-1 */
table.contenttable-1 {
	border: 0;
}

table.contenttable-1 th {
	border: 0;
	vertical-align:top;
}

table.contenttable-1 td {
	border: 0;
	vertical-align:top;
}

/* contenttable-2 */
table.contenttable-2 {
	border: 0;
	table-layout: fixed;
	width: 100%;
}

table.contenttable-2 th {
	border: 0;
	vertical-align:top;
}

table.contenttable-2 td {
	border: 0;
	vertical-align:top;
}

/* -----------------------------------------------
	td styles
----------------------------------------------- */

/* datum */
#austellungFrame td.contenttd-1,
#austellungFrame td.contenttd-1 * {
	font-weight: bold;
	color: #999;
}

#austellungFrame td.contenttd-1 {
	padding-bottom: 15px;
}

/* �berschrift */
#austellungFrame td.contenttd-2,
#austellungFrame td.contenttd-2 * {
	font-weight: bold;
	color: #666;
}

/* untertitel */
#austellungFrame td.contenttd-3,
#austellungFrame td.contenttd-3 * {
	font-weight: bold;
	color: #999;
}

/* ort */
#austellungFrame td.contenttd-4,
#austellungFrame td.contenttd-4 * {
	font-weight: bold;
	color: #999;
}

#austellungFrame td.contenttd-4 {
	padding-top: 15px;
}

/* vernissage */
#austellungFrame td.contenttd-5,
#austellungFrame td.contenttd-5 * {
	font-weight: bold;
	color: #999;
}

/* links */
#austellungFrame td.contenttd-6,
#austellungFrame td.contenttd-6 * {
	font-weight: bold;
	color: #f18d32;
}

/* warnung */
#austellungFrame td.contenttd-7,
#austellungFrame td.contenttd-7 * {
	color: #ff0000 !important;
}
